Języki

Erudis - your road to knowledge
Analiza systemów informatycznych w języku UML z wykorzystaniem Enterprise Architect

Opis szkolenia
Szkolenie jest przeznaczone dla osób zajmujących się modelowaniem różnych aspektów systemów informatycznych. Pokazuje język UML w kontekście pewnego uproszczonego procesu. W połączeniu z wykorzystaniem Enterprise Architect do budowy pełnego modelu pozwala to lepiej zrozumieć nie tylko elementy języka UML ale także ich zastosowanie.

Celem szkolenia jest przygotowanie członków zespołu analitycznego do praktycznego wykorzystania UML w projektach. Ponadto szkolenie pozwala zrozumieć jak wykorzystać możliwości narzędzia Enterprise Architect do zarządzania informacjami projektowymi.

Dla kogo
Szkolenie przeznaczone jest dla analityków, kierowników projektów i specjalistów ds. zapewnienia jakości oraz wszystkich osób zajmujących się zbieraniem wymagań bądź wykorzystywaniem wymagań w swojej pracy.

Program szkolenia

  1. Wprowadzenie do tworzenia systemów i historia UML.
    Krótki wstęp do inżynierii oprogramowania i procesów wytwórczych (RUP, XP) połączony ze wstępem do UML.
  2. Podstawy UML i metody rozszerzania UML.
    Omówienie fundamentów struktury UML, konsekwencji takiej struktury oraz metod rozszerzania standardu o dodatkowe informacje, które nie dają się wprost modelować.
  3. Wprowadzenie do EA.
    Omówienie środowiska narzędzia, sposobów tworzenia projektu, konfiguracji projektu, istotnych elementów konfiguracji środowiska.
  4. Tworzenie diagramów i organizacja projektu w EA.
    Opis podstaw organizacji modelu – jak tworzyć strukturę modelu, jakie diagramy wykorzystywać i gdzie. Tworzenie i edytowanie diagramów.
  5. Modelowanie procesów w UML.
    Omówienie modelowania środowiska procesów, oraz szczegółowego modelu procesów opartego o diagram czynności. Wykorzystanie Enterprise Architect do tworzenia efektywnych modeli procesów.
  6. Model pojęciowy systemu.
    Techniki budowania i opisywania pojęć w systemie informatycznym. Tworzenie diagramu pojęciowego – uproszczonego diagramu klas. Opisywanie stanów pojęć.
  7. Modelowanie wymagań w UML.
    Opisanie sposobów modelowania wymagań w UML, wykorzystania diagramów przypadków użycia, systemowych przypadków użycia oraz krótkie wprowadzenie do innych diagramów, które mogą zostać użyte do reprezentacji wymagań. Wykorzystanie Enterprise Architect do tworzenia opisu wymagań, który może być podstawą późniejszych realizacji.
  8. Modelowanie szczegółów przypadków użycia.
    Modelowanie interakcji z użytkownikiem, podstawy modelu komunikacji pomiędzy ekranami systemu. Techniczne rozwinięcie przypadków użycia na poziomie analitycznym.
  9. Modelowanie wdrożenia.
    Omówienie modelu produktów projektu i modelu środowiska istniejącego i docelowego systemu. Diagramy komponentów i wdrożenia (rozmieszczenia).
  10. Dokumentowanie projektu.
    Tworzenie dokumentacji projektowej – szczegóły tworzenia szablonów, zarządzania dokumentami oraz tworzenia wirtualnych dokumentów. 

Tematy dodatkowe

  1. Zarządzanie modelem.
    Omówienie rodzajów repozytoriów – kryteria wyboru, sposób konfiguracji repozytorium bazodanowego oraz możliwe operacje na repozytoriach.
  2. Praca zespołowa.
    Omówienie elementów Enterprise Architect wspierających pracę zespołową oraz użycie systemu kontroli wersji.

 

Sprawy organizacyjne

Czas trwania szkolenia: 3 dni

Cena netto: 2700 PLN

Forma: wykład+ćwiczenia

 


Szkolenia dedykowane

Cena, czas trwania szkolenia dedykowanego jest uzależniony od potrzeb klienta i rozmiaru koniecznych modyfikacji szkolenia standardowego. W celu ustalenia szczegółów i warunków szkolenia prosimy o skontaktowanie się z nami e-mailem (szkolenia@erudis.pl) bądź telefonicznie.


Zgłoszenia

Osoby zainteresowane szkoleniem prosimy o wypełnienie formularza zamówienia: wersja PDF lub RTF i wysłanie go e-mailem (szkolenia@erudis.pl) lub faxem.